About N-benzyl-1H-indole-2-carboxamide

N-benzyl-1H-indole-2-carboxamide (PubChem CID 8023988) has the molecular formula C16H14N2O and a molecular weight of 250.30 g/mol. Its IUPAC name is N-benzyl-1H-indole-2-carboxamide.
